2. Ingredients for Your Forest Veggie Skewers
To create these fantastic Forager’s Veggie Skewers, gather the following ingredients:
- 1 Zucchini, sliced
- 1 Bell Pepper, cut into chunks
- 1 Cup Cherry Tomatoes
- 1 Red Onion, quartered
- 1 Cup Mushrooms, whole
- 2 Tablespoons Olive Oil
- 1 Teaspoon Garlic Powder
- 1 Teaspoon Italian Herbs (Oregano, Basil, Thyme)
- Salt and Pepper to taste
- Skewers (wooden or metal)
3. Preparation: Crafting Your Chris Hemsworth Inspired Veggie Skewers
Step 1: Chopping the Vegetables for the Veggie Skewers

Begin by thoroughly washing and chopping your fresh vegetables. Cut the zucchini into half-moon shapes, the bell pepper into bite-sized chunks, and quarter the red onion. Make sure to keep the cherry tomatoes whole and the mushrooms intact for a delightful texture. Proper preparation ensures that each skewer is packed with a variety of flavors, reflecting the natural bounty of the forest.
Step 2: Assemble the Skewers for Grilling

Take your skewers and start threading the vegetables in an alternating fashion. For example, start with a cherry tomato, then a piece of zucchini, followed by a bell pepper chunk, and so on. Repeat until the skewer is filled, leaving a little space at the ends for handling. Arranging the vegetables artfully on the skewers not only makes them visually appealing but also ensures even cooking. Get creative and consider adding other veggies like squash or eggplant. Step 3: Grilling the Skewers to Perfection

Preheat your grill and brush it lightly with olive oil to prevent sticking. Place the skewers on the grill and cook for about 10-15 minutes, turning occasionally until the vegetables are tender and have beautiful grill marks. The smell will transport you straight to the forest! The grilling process enhances the natural sweetness of the vegetables, giving them a smoky, charred flavor that is simply irresistible. Keep an eye on the skewers to prevent burning, and adjust the grilling time as needed based on your grill’s heat.
Step 4: Plating and Serving Your Veggie Creations

Once grilled to perfection, remove the skewers from the grill and let them cool slightly. Arrange them beautifully on a serving platter to showcase their vibrant colors. You can serve these Forrest Forager’s Veggie Skewers with a side of your favorite dipping sauce or a fresh salad. A drizzle of balsamic glaze or a sprinkle of fresh herbs can add an extra touch of elegance to the presentation.
4. Storage Tips for Your Leftover Veggie Skewers
If you have any leftovers, store the cooled skewers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. They can easily be reheated on the grill or in the oven to revive their grilled flavor. Enjoy them cold in a salad for a quick meal option!
